4,294,992,810 is a composite number, even.
4,294,992,810 (four billion two hundred ninety-four million nine hundred ninety-two thousand eight hundred ten) is an even 10-digit number. It is a composite number with 16 divisors, and factors as 2 × 3 × 5 × 143,166,427. Its proper divisors sum to 6,012,990,006,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1000063AA.
